You cannot push anyone up the ladder unless he is willing to climb.

Andrew Carnegie

About This Quote

Often presented as a motivational line about mentoring or management: help from others can’t substitute for a person’s own effort and choice to improve.

Interpretation

Support and opportunity matter, but progress requires the individual’s active participation; you can assist, but you can’t force someone to grow or advance.
